首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用MySQL中的Json字段,获取不一致的行为(C#)

MySQL中的JSON字段是一种特殊的数据类型,它允许存储和操作JSON格式的数据。使用MySQL中的JSON字段,可以实现一些非常灵活和强大的功能。

获取不一致的行为可以通过以下步骤实现:

  1. 创建一个包含JSON字段的表:CREATE TABLE my_table ( id INT PRIMARY KEY AUTO_INCREMENT, data JSON );
  2. 插入一些包含不一致数据的行:INSERT INTO my_table (data) VALUES ('{"name": "John", "age": 25}'), ('{"name": "Jane", "age": 30, "city": "New York"}'), ('{"name": "Tom", "age": 35, "city": "London", "hobbies": ["reading", "traveling"]}');
  3. 使用JSON函数查询不一致的行为:SELECT * FROM my_table WHERE JSON_LENGTH(data) <> 2;上述查询语句将返回包含不一致数据的行,因为其中的JSON字段的长度不等于2。

JSON字段的优势在于它可以存储和查询结构化的数据,而无需使用传统的关系型数据库表格。它适用于存储和处理具有不确定结构的数据,例如日志、配置文件、用户自定义字段等。

在腾讯云的产品中,推荐使用云数据库MySQL来支持JSON字段的存储和查询。云数据库MySQL是腾讯云提供的一种高性能、可扩展的关系型数据库服务,支持主从复制、自动备份、容灾等功能。您可以通过以下链接了解更多关于云数据库MySQL的信息:云数据库MySQL产品介绍

请注意,本回答仅提供了MySQL中使用JSON字段获取不一致行为的基本方法和腾讯云产品的推荐,具体的实现和应用场景可能因实际需求而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共30个视频
web前端进阶教程-轻松玩转AJAX技术【动力节点】
动力节点Java培训
传统开发的缺点,是对于浏览器的页面,全部都是全局刷新的体验。如果我们只是想取得或是更新页面中的部分信息那么就必须要应用到局部刷新的技术。局部刷新也是有效提升用户体验的一种非常重要的方式。 本课程会通过对ajax的传统使用方式,结合json操作的方式,结合跨域等高级技术的方式,对ajax做一个全面的讲解。
领券